본문 바로가기

전체 글60

Stable Diffusion Webui-Embedding, Vae 지난 번 강좌에서는 시비타이 사이트에서 샘플이미지를 참고하고 원하는 모델을 다운로드 한 다음 설치해서 사용해 보는 방법을 배웠보았다. 최근에는 부정프롬프트나 기본 설정값을 모두 포함하여 최적화 한 파일이 많이 올라와 있지만, Embedding과 Vae를 활용해 모델을 더 섬세하고 디테일하게 완성도를 높이는 방법을 알아두면 좋을것 같아 정리해 본다. 1. Embedding 1.1 Embedding 임베딩이란 이미지를 생성하다보면 정상적이지 않은 팔과 다리 모양, 갯수가 넘치는 손가락, 다리 등 상식적이지 않은 형태의 결과물이 나올 때가 많다. Embedding은 이미지의 기본 모델에는 영향을 주지 않으면서도 꼭 지켜줬으면 하는 부분들만 종합하여 학습시켜놓은 모델이기 때문에 파일 용량이 작다. 부정프롬프트 .. 2024. 4. 7.
Stable Diffusion Webui-CIVITAI에서 모델 다운 및 세팅 이번 챕터에서는 스테이블 디퓨전으로 이미지를 생성할 때 퀄리티를 높이기 위한 최소한의 설정 방법을 알아보기로 하자. 1. 체크포인트 모델 추가 1.1 모델 선택 먼저, 이미지 생성에 사용할 체크포인트 모델을 선택하기 위해 https://civitai.com/ 에 접속한다. civitai는 가장 많은 모델을 보유하고 있고 끊임없이 새로운 모델이 업로드 되어 사용자들이 가장 많이 찿는 사이트다. 사이트 상단 메뉴의 모델을 클릭하면 엄청나게 고퀄리티의 이미지들이 썸네일로 뜬다. 모든 이미지를 대상으로 우리에게 적합한 모델을 고르려면 시작도 하기 전에 진이 빠질테니 상단 오른쪽 필터 메뉴에서 필요한 것만 클릭해보자. 모델타입은 체크포인트, 베이스 모델은 SD 1.5로 선택 해주면 우리가 사용 할 버전에 맞는 모.. 2024. 3. 28.
Stable Diffusion Webui 설치와 기본 설명 지금부터 스테이블 디퓨전을 내가 배우는 흐름으로 정리해 보려고 한다. 프로그램을 설치하고 이미지를 생성해 보면서 어느 정도 수준의 전문가가 될 때까지 완성도를 향상시키는것이 이 시리즈를 기획한 목적이다. 너무 막막한 한 걸음이지만 어느새 도달해 있는 내 모습을 상상해 보며, 혹시라도 함께 하실 분들도 모두 화이팅!^^ 기본적인 환경 - Nvidia VRAM 6GB 이상의 그래픽 카드, RTX 2080 이상 권장. - RAM 8GB 이상의 메모리, 16GB 이상 권장 - 하드디스크의 여유 공간은 최소 10GB 이상이고 체크포인트나 모델, 임베딩, 베 등 용량이 꽤 큰 파일들을 다운받고 계속 추가해야하기 때문에 여유공간을 크게 가지고 있어야 작업시 자유롭다. 설치 순서 1. Python 설치 :다운로드 페이.. 2024. 3. 27.
프롬프트 엔지니어가 되려면? 핵심가이드 2 지난편에서 다뤘던 chat GPT와 대화하는 방법이 익숙해졌다면 그 방법을 응용해 그림을 생성할 수 있다. 프롬프트는 영어로만 인식하기 때문에 영어에 익숙하지 않은 사람들에게는 표현이 많이 어렵다. 처음에는 한글로 만든 문장을 구글 번역기로 돌렸고 나중에 구글의 확장프로그램을 설치해서 자동번역해주는 기능을 썼다. 그 방법이 틀린 건 아니지만 chat GPT를 활용하면 아이디어 도움을 받을 수 있어서 더 재미있는 프롬프트를 얻을 수 있다. 22년 미드저니와 달리라는 이미지 생성 AI 일반인에게 오픈 된 후 수없이 많은 이미지 생성 도구가 생겨나고 있다. 어떤것은 이미 유료화를 시작하고 있고 어떤것은 무료로 기반을 다지고 있다. 오늘은 Stable Diffusion의 경량화된 서비스로 최근 발표된 forge.. 2024. 3. 25.